Flavia Molina - Chief Marketing Officer
Flavia Molina, the Chief Marketing Officer at Camil Alimentos, architects the brand strategy and consumer engagement initiatives for the company's extensive portfolio. Overseeing the positioning of brands such as Camil, Coqueiro, União, and Santa Amália, the Chief Marketing Officer drives market penetration and brand loyalty across diverse demographics. INTERFLOUR Group is a leading flour milling company in Southeast Asia, operating 10 mills across Indonesia, Malaysia, Vietnam, and the Philippines with a total milling capacity exceeding 2 million tons per year. The company is committed to providing high-quality, consistent flour products and outstanding customer service, supported by rigorous food safety and quality certifications.
